I've just applied the patches and some tweaks to the 1.4.0 base
and they seem to work ok.  I also tweaked some errno
handling in the patch and fixed a bug whereby a failed fstat
would return no result to a lock attempt.

The #ifdef SunOS probably should be replaced with #ifdef HAS_BROKEN_FLOCK
in most cases, as there are probably other SVR4 systems out
there that could benefit from this multi-threaded locking support.

I enclose my patch relative to the 1.4.0 base (with more context
than the original patch as patching from that gave some errors).

I also enclose a fix for Solaris and any other SVR4 based system
to support logfile rotation using SIGHUP... the original
code would die on the 2nd SIGHUP due to the signal handler
not being reinstated.  Using sigaction instead on such systems.
(#ifdef SA_RESTART)

I also tweaked configure for Solaris 9 x86, as it only supported
recognition of sparc with gcc.
